A versão curta
Uma TWA envolve seu PWA para que ele abra como um app Android independente, sem barra de endereços ou barra de ferramentas do navegador. Em vez de incluir um navegador embutido desatualizado, ele toma emprestado o motor Chrome instalado do usuário — assim você obtém os recursos mais recentes da plataforma web, patches de segurança e desempenho, gratuitamente.
TWA vs WebView vs nativo
Uma WebView clássica inclui um motor de renderização separado, geralmente desatualizado — mais lento e inconsistente. Um app totalmente nativo significa reescrever seu produto em Kotlin ou Java. Uma TWA ocupa o ponto ideal: seu web app existente, o motor Chrome mais recente, empacotado como um .aab real — sem reescrita.
O que uma TWA exige
Seu site deve ser instalável: servido via HTTPS, com um manifesto de web app válido e um service worker. A propriedade do domínio é verificada com Digital Asset Links (um arquivo assetlinks.json em seu domínio), que é o que remove a barra de endereços. Se seu site não tiver service worker, um build do Capacitor é a alternativa.
Como o SaaSToStore usa isso
O SaaSToStore constrói sua TWA automaticamente com o Bubblewrap, gera o keystore, escreve o assetlinks.json e entrega um .aab assinado pronto para o Google Play — sem Android Studio. Se seu PWA não tiver service worker, ele volta automaticamente para um build do Capacitor para que você nunca fique bloqueado.